File xmbase-grok-1.5-ia64.diff of Package xmbase-grok

--- src/formwin.c
+++ src/formwin.c
@@ -683,7 +683,7 @@
 	  case 0x114: set_toggle(w, form->syncable);			break;
 	  case 0x105: set_toggle(w, form->proc);
 		      fillout_formedit_widget_by_code(0x106);		break;
-	  case 0x106: XtVaSetValues(w, XmNsensitive, form->proc, 0);	break;
+	  case 0x106: XtVaSetValues(w, XmNsensitive, form->proc, NULL);	break;
 
 	  case IT_LABEL:
 	  case IT_PRINT:
--- src/mainwin.c
+++ src/mainwin.c
@@ -145,7 +145,7 @@
 			XmVaCASCADEBUTTON, s[5], 'H',
 			NULL);
 	if (w = XtNameToWidget(menubar, "button_5"))
-		XtVaSetValues(menubar, XmNmenuHelpWidget, w, 0);
+		XtVaSetValues(menubar, XmNmenuHelpWidget, w, NULL);
 	sectpdcall = XtNameToWidget(menubar, "button_2");
 	for (n=0; n < 5; n++)
 		XmStringFree(s[n]);
@@ -187,7 +187,7 @@
 		XmStringFree(s[n]);
 
 	if (restricted && (w = XtNameToWidget(fmenu, "button_4")))
-		XtVaSetValues(w, XmNsensitive, FALSE, 0);
+		XtVaSetValues(w, XmNsensitive, FALSE, NULL);
 
 	s[0] = XmStringCreateSimple("Edit current form...");
 	s[1] = XmStringCreateSimple("Create new form from scratch...");
@@ -792,7 +792,7 @@
 			db[i].widget = XtCreateManagedWidget(db[i].name+1,
 				xmPushButtonGadgetClass, dbpulldown, NULL, 0);
 			XtAddCallback(db[i].widget, XmNactivateCallback,
-				(XtCallbackProc)dbase_pulldown, (XtPointer)i);
+				(XtCallbackProc)dbase_pulldown, (XtPointer)((long int)i));
 		}
 	}
 }
@@ -859,7 +859,7 @@
 		scwidget[n] = 0;
 	}
 	if (!curr_card || !curr_card->dbase || curr_card->form->proc) {
-		XtVaSetValues(sectpdcall, XmNsensitive, FALSE, 0);
+		XtVaSetValues(sectpdcall, XmNsensitive, FALSE, NULL);
 		return;
 	}
 	maxn = curr_card->dbase->havesects ? curr_card->dbase->nsects + 2 : 1;
@@ -877,7 +877,7 @@
 				(XtCallbackProc)section_pulldown,(XtPointer)n);
 		free(name[n]);
 	}
-	XtVaSetValues(sectpdcall, XmNsensitive, TRUE, 0);
+	XtVaSetValues(sectpdcall, XmNsensitive, TRUE, NULL);
 #ifdef XmNtearOffModel
 	XtVaSetValues(sectpulldown, XmNtearOffModel, XmTEAR_OFF_ENABLED, NULL);
 #endif
@@ -1043,7 +1043,7 @@
 				section_name(curr_card->dbase, i),
 				xmPushButtonGadgetClass, popup, NULL, 0);
 		XtAddCallback(pwidgets[i], XmNactivateCallback,
-				(XtCallbackProc)sect_callback, (XtPointer)i);
+				(XtCallbackProc)sect_callback, (XtPointer)((long int)i));
 	}
 	XtManageChild(w_sect);
 #endif
openSUSE Build Service is sponsored by